Adult Education Skills Tutor - CASUAL (with a focus on EYP and Vocational)

Adult Education Skills Tutor - CASUAL (with a focus on EYP and Vocational)

Teaching
£34,434 - £36,363 per year

About the role

Responsible for the facilitation of learning and skill development of learners in various subjects and areas of knowledge. To create engaging lesson plans, deliver instruction tailored to diverse learning styles and levels, and assess students' progress. To adapt teaching methods accordingly and implement support measures. Responsible for the completion of all tutor activity including individual learning plans, progression, administration and other associated activities. Additionally provide support and encouragement to learners, fostering a positive and inclusive learning environment conducive to personal growth and achievement, while also promoting lifelong learning and empowerment within their adult student community. You will have a good level of EYP, Education or Health & Social Care knowledge.

What will you be doing?

  1. Provide a scheme of work and other related information, including course and lesson planning and preparation of appropriate teaching resources. Your primary focus will be EYFS education, you may be offered courses in other curriculum areas
  2. To undertake scheduled teaching activities, assessment and support, in line with funding rules.
  3. Provide support to learners including pre-course, on course and exit advice and guidance as directed by the programme management team.
  4. Participate in training and other continuous professional development including induction, staff meetings, tutor forums and on-line training packages(including those related to Inspection).
  5. Participate in developing and implementing quality assurance arrangements and administrative duties relating to the course.
  6. To ensure the curriculum meets the requirements of validating and awarding bodies and support with the development of courses.
  1. Provide students with appropriate tutorial support in accordance with programme and individual requirements.
  2. To take responsibility for Health and Safety issues relating to the course and the students in compliance with Northamptonshire County Council Health and Safety Policy.

About you

We are looking for a dedicated and results-driven educator who is passionate about delivering high-quality adult education. As a natural collaborator, you take pride in improving learner outcomes and thrive in an environment that prioritizes continuous improvement.

To be successful in this role, you will possess the following:

  • Qualifications: A minimum of a Level 3 qualification in your specialist subject area, or equivalent extensive experience. You must also hold a Level 2 qualification in both English and Maths.
  • Digital Literacy: A Level 2 qualification in ICT (or equivalent). Note: We will consider candidates with a willingness to work towards this Level 2 ICT requirement.
  • Teaching Experience: Proven track record of working with adult learners as a teacher, trainer, instructor, or tutor.
  • Quality & Assurance: Hands-on experience applying quality improvement processes (including internal verification) and a demonstrated history of improving learner outcomes and the overall quality of education.
  • Ability to travel freely as operationally required between locations in North and West Northamptonshire.
